Transaction afa5084129323166e406c4d479680a39b98cf81a376f5d240c501d0af1e28c9f

1 Input
2 Outputs
  • afa5084129323166e406c4d479680a39b98cf81a376f5d240c501d0af1e28c9f:0
  • value  26706646
    address  3ChLu8qj48j3faY8ugKwt5p1rucmdBmgKw
  • afa5084129323166e406c4d479680a39b98cf81a376f5d240c501d0af1e28c9f:1
  • value  4000000
    address  3DJvNaqCXopDFCtzHb6fRWVbr87kdTSW6y